#c8c6da - Pax color

Soft, muted lavender-gray with cool periwinkle undertones, this pale color feels serene and refined. It evokes airy, vintage-modern aesthetics and reads as calming on large surfaces. Ideal for backgrounds, stationery, and minimalist interiors, it pairs beautifully with deep navy or charcoal for contrast, warm cream or blush for warmth, and brushed gold for a touch of elegance. Use it to create peaceful interfaces or sophisticated branding, but ensure sufficient contrast for readable text when applied to UI components.

#c8c6da color RGB value is 200, 198, 218, and the CMYK value is 0.0826, 0.0917, 0.00, 0.145. Alternative names for that color are: pax, white, lightsteelblue, gray suit, periwinkle, violet.
